Abstract

Character expansion developed in real space renormalization group (RSRG) approach is applied to U(1) lattice gauge theory with $\th$-term in 2 dimensions. Topological charge distribution $P(Q)$ is shown to be of Gaussian form at any $\b$(inverse coupling constant). The partition function $Z(\th)$ at large volume is shown to be given by the elliptic theta function. It provides the information of the zeros of partition function as an analytic function of $\ze= e^{i \th}$ ($\th$ = theta parameter). These partition function zeros lead to the phase transition at $\th=\pi$. Analytical results will be compared with the MC simulation results. In MC simulation, we adopt (i)``set method" and (ii)``trial function method".
